MySQL是一個流行的開源數(shù)據(jù)庫管理系統(tǒng),它支持在本地和遠(yuǎn)程服務(wù)器通過TCP/IP連接訪問。如果您在MySQL服務(wù)器上安裝多個應(yīng)用程序,并想讓這些應(yīng)用程序能夠在任何主機上遠(yuǎn)程訪問這些MySQL數(shù)據(jù)庫,則需要將該數(shù)據(jù)庫服務(wù)器配置為允許遠(yuǎn)程訪問。
在MySQL 2005中,允許遠(yuǎn)程訪問本地服務(wù)是非常簡單的。在MySQL服務(wù)器上,您需要更改配置文件,以指定允許來自遠(yuǎn)程主機的連接。
1. 打開MySQL服務(wù)器的配置文件 my.ini。 2. 找到并編輯 [mysqld] 部分。 3. 添加以下行: bind-address=0.0.0.0 skip-networking=false 4. 保存并關(guān)閉該文件。 5. 重新啟動MySQL服務(wù)器以應(yīng)用更改。
當(dāng)MySQL服務(wù)器重新啟動時,現(xiàn)在可以從任何主機連接到MySQL服務(wù)器了。但是請注意,允許來自所有遠(yuǎn)程主機的連接可能會增加數(shù)據(jù)庫服務(wù)器的風(fēng)險。因此,建議您限制來自已知IP地址的連接,或通過更安全的方法進(jìn)行訪問,例如使用 SSH 隧道。